Re: kill -9 mount, ytterligare ledtråd.

2003-08-04 tråd Tommy Dugandzic
On 4 Aug 2003, Torbjörn Svensson wrote:

> > De gamla hängde "mount /dev/hdb1"-processerna går dock fortfarande inte 
> > att döda med kill -9.
> 
> ur 'man ps':
>   PROCESS STATE CODES
>   D uninterruptible sleep (usually IO)
> kanske är något som säger dig något om varför den inte dör ?

Jo, en ledtråd iaf. Jag kollade man ps och man kill, men ingen av sidorna 
skrev hur man kunde få död på sådana processer. Nästa steg blir väl 
google. Det vore intressant att veta hur annars jag skulle kunnat ha dödat 
dem utan att behöva starta om datorn. Inte för att jag någonsin kommer 
redigera /etc/mtab istället för /etc/fstab, men vafa* :).

> > Nähe.. Nu hängde sig Bash igen. Fast inga felmeddelanden. Däremot 
> > "klickade den till" med ett ljud som påminner mig om klickandet när en hd 
> > var fysiskt trasig. Hmm.. Jag provar:
> 
> Prova 'fsck /dev/hdb1' istället.

Jo, det vore väl ett bättre test.

> Hoppas du har blivit lite klokare :-)

Jodå, bra ledtråd där, som jag missade. Tack :),

-- 
Regards,
 
Tommy - http://www.geocities.com/todu5811/autosignature?1142
RFC2440 fingerprint: 4445 BB5E AE67 A0C9 7B25  5715 F938 88CB 7A10 2364
 



Re: kill -9 mount, ytterligare ledtråd.

2003-08-04 tråd Tommy Dugandzic
On Mon, 4 Aug 2003, Johan Björklund wrote:

> > # umount /dev/hdb1
> > Cannot create link /etc/mtab~
> > Perhaps there is a stale lock file?
> > 
> > Varför ska den hålla på med min backup-fil som texteditorn joe automatiskt 
> > skapar? Hmm..
> > 
> > # mv /etc/mtab~ /etc/mtab~.tommy
> 
> Du verkar vara en aningens ambitiös. /etc/mtab är en systemfil som
> kerneln använder för att hålla reda på vilka filsystem som är monterade.
> Den ska man _aldrig_ röra, om man inte vill ha problem ...

Hehe, och problem är vad jag fick :).

> Antagligen har du blandat ihop /etc/fstab och /etc/mtab. Om du lägger
> till din rad i /etc/fstab och försöker igen borde det gå bättre,
> förutsatt att /etc/mtab är hel.

Japp, så var fallet. Pga min enkelspårighet fortsatte jag på fel spår rätt 
långt innan jag vände för att kolla den andra avfarten. Men efter ett "man 
fstab", "man mount" och lite experimenterande lyckades jag få en 
fungerande lösning. Efter att ha tagit bort /etc/mtab~ så har datorn 
dessutom slutat klaga. Nu återstår bara att läsa lite "man ps" som 
Torbjörn föreslog i ett senare mail så jag lär mig varför mina elaka 
processer blev så odödliga. Jag lovar att aldrig mer pilla på /etc/mtab 
;).

> Hoppas du har blivit lite klokare!

Japp, tack för hjälpen!

-- 
Regards,
 
Tommy - http://www.geocities.com/todu5811/autosignature?1141
RFC2440 fingerprint: 4445 BB5E AE67 A0C9 7B25  5715 F938 88CB 7A10 2364
 





Re: kill -9 mount, ytterligare ledtråd.

2003-08-04 tråd Torbjörn Svensson
On Mon, 2003-08-04 at 14:06, Tommy Dugandzic wrote:
> De gamla hängde "mount /dev/hdb1"-processerna går dock fortfarande inte 
> att döda med kill -9.

ur 'man ps':
PROCESS STATE CODES
D uninterruptible sleep (usually IO)
kanske är något som säger dig något om varför den inte dör ?

> # mount /dev/hdb1
> mount: can't find /dev/hdb1 in /etc/fstab or /etc/mtab
> 
> Jaha? Så nu tar sig datorn friheten att på eget bevåg ta bort raden jag 
> nyss lade till i /etc/mtab för min /dev/hdb1. Jag lägger väl dit den igen 
> och är noga med att avsluta filens innehåll med en radbrytning denna gång 
> då.

Du har torligtvis blandat ihop '/ect/mtab' med '/etc/fstab'

> Nähe.. Nu hängde sig Bash igen. Fast inga felmeddelanden. Däremot 
> "klickade den till" med ett ljud som påminner mig om klickandet när en hd 
> var fysiskt trasig. Hmm.. Jag provar:

Prova 'fsck /dev/hdb1' istället.

Hoppas du har blivit lite klokare :-)
//Tobbe


signature.asc
Description: This is a digitally signed message part


Re: kill -9 mount, ytterlig are ledtråd.

2003-08-04 tråd Peter Mathiasson
On Mon, Aug 04, 2003 at 02:46:11PM +0200, Johan Björklund wrote:
> Du verkar vara en aningens ambitiös. /etc/mtab är en systemfil som
> kerneln använder för att hålla reda på vilka filsystem som är monterade.
> Den ska man _aldrig_ röra, om man inte vill ha problem ...

/etc/mtab anvands av mount, inte av karnan. Karnan sparar sjalv det
mesta av informationen fran /etc/mtab, tillganglig via /proc/mounts.

-- 
Peter Mathiasson, peter at mathiasson dot nu, http://www.mathiasson.nu
GPG Fingerprint: A9A7 F8F6 9821 F415 B066 77F1 7FF5 C2E6 7BF2 F228



Re: kill -9 mount, ytterlig are ledtråd.

2003-08-04 tråd Johan Björklund
On Mon, Aug 04, 2003 at 14:06 CEST, 
 Tommy Dugandzic <[EMAIL PROTECTED]> wrote:
> # umount /dev/hdb1
> Cannot create link /etc/mtab~
> Perhaps there is a stale lock file?
> 
> Varför ska den hålla på med min backup-fil som texteditorn joe automatiskt 
> skapar? Hmm..
> 
> # mv /etc/mtab~ /etc/mtab~.tommy

Du verkar vara en aningens ambitiös. /etc/mtab är en systemfil som
kerneln använder för att hålla reda på vilka filsystem som är monterade.
Den ska man _aldrig_ röra, om man inte vill ha problem ...

Antagligen har du blandat ihop /etc/fstab och /etc/mtab. Om du lägger
till din rad i /etc/fstab och försöker igen borde det gå bättre,
förutsatt att /etc/mtab är hel.

Hoppas du har blivit lite klokare!

mvh
-- 
+---+
| Johan Björklund <[EMAIL PROTECTED]> http://whero.net/ |
|  PGP = 813B 014F C0FA B56C FA70  31DC 1C11 3A20 B02B C881 |
+---+
| RADIO SHACK LEVEL II BASIC
| READY
| >_
+ -- -  --- -- -



kill -9 mount, ytterligare ledtråd.

2003-08-04 tråd Tommy Dugandzic
# mount
/dev/hdb1 /mnt/8gig ext3 rw 0 0

Så den tror den är mountad alltså.

# umount /dev/hdb1
Cannot create link /etc/mtab~
Perhaps there is a stale lock file?

Varför ska den hålla på med min backup-fil som texteditorn joe automatiskt 
skapar? Hmm..

# mv /etc/mtab~ /etc/mtab~.tommy

# umount /dev/hdb1
umount: /dev/hdb1: not mounted

De gamla hängde "mount /dev/hdb1"-processerna går dock fortfarande inte 
att döda med kill -9.

# mount /dev/hdb1
mount: can't find /dev/hdb1 in /etc/fstab or /etc/mtab

Jaha? Så nu tar sig datorn friheten att på eget bevåg ta bort raden jag 
nyss lade till i /etc/mtab för min /dev/hdb1. Jag lägger väl dit den igen 
och är noga med att avsluta filens innehåll med en radbrytning denna gång 
då.

..eller förresten: Jag kör denna rad istället som jag vet funkade innan 
allt strul med dem odödliga, hängda processerna:

# mount /dev/hdb1 /mnt/8gig/

Nähe.. Nu hängde sig Bash igen. Fast inga felmeddelanden. Däremot 
"klickade den till" med ett ljud som påminner mig om klickandet när en hd 
var fysiskt trasig. Hmm.. Jag provar:

# fdisk /dev/hdb

Det gick bra.

Command (m for help): p
 
Disk /dev/hdb: 255 heads, 63 sectors, 1027 cylinders
Units = cylinders of 16065 * 512 bytes
 
   Device BootStart   EndBlocks   Id  System
/dev/hdb1 1  1027   8249346   83  Linux

Hmm.. Fdisk kan man ju tänka sig skulle klaga om den inte kunde prata med 
hdb alls.

dmesg klagar inte heller på ngt hd-relaterat. Äh, jag startar väl om 
datorn då för att åtminstone utesluta hårdvarufel. Jag återkommer :).

-- 
Regards,
 
Tommy - http://www.geocities.com/todu5811/autosignature?1140
RFC2440 fingerprint: 4445 BB5E AE67 A0C9 7B25  5715 F938 88CB 7A10 2364
 



kill -9 funkar inte.

2003-08-04 tråd Tommy Dugandzic
# ps aux|grep mount
root 29636  0.0  0.0  1696  624 pts/6D13:28   0:00 mount 
/dev/hdb1
root 29656  0.0  0.0  1700  612 pts/2D13:30   0:00 mount 
/dev/hdb1

# kill -9 29636
# ps aux|grep mount
root 29636  0.0  0.0  1696  624 pts/6D13:28   0:00 mount
/dev/hdb1
root 29656  0.0  0.0  1700  612 pts/2D13:30   0:00 mount
/dev/hdb1

Varför? Jag trodde kill -9 alltid kunde döda alla processer. Anledningen 
att första mount-processen hängde sig förmodar jag är därför att jag 
råkade glömma att avsluta sista raden i filen /etc/mtab med en 
radbrytning. Bash klagade på det iaf. Men sen när jag fixade radbrytningen 
i /etc/mtab så hängde sig mount igen. Förmodligen pga den redan hängda 
mount-processen jag inte fick död på sedan tidigare.

Det kan ju även vara fel på raden i /etc/mtab. Den ser ut såhär:
/dev/hdb1 /mnt/8gig ext3 rw 0 0

Denna rad funkar sedan tidigare:
/dev/hdc1 /mnt/40gig vfat rw 0 0

Jag vet dock inte vad de två nollorna står för.

Snälla hjälp mig - jag vill inte sabba min uptime ;).

-- 
Regards,
 
Tommy - http://www.geocities.com/todu5811/autosignature?1139
RFC2440 fingerprint: 4445 BB5E AE67 A0C9 7B25  5715 F938 88CB 7A10 2364
 



LPI "studiegrupp"

2003-08-04 tråd Johan Blom
Tjena

Detta är inte direkt debian specifikt men jag gör ett försök ändå. 
Finns det någon/några i sthlm som är intresserade av att göra någon form
av "studiegrupp" för att ta LPI Certen?

/Johan



Re: Java på unstable

2003-08-04 tråd Christoffer Sawicki
On Monday 04 August 2003 03:33, Joakim Nordberg wrote:
> jag hittadade denna info (kanske den du menade)
> http://jrfonseca.dyndns.org/debian/
>
> "Blackdown Java 1.4.1-01 for gcc-3.2
> The Blackdown project supposedly should have release newer Debian packages
> by now. The existing ones don't work with the latest Mozilla packages
> (compiled with gcc-3.2). I got tired waiting and after installing java by
> hand once I decided it wasn't a experience to repeat, so I've made my own
> packages. These packages were based on the j2se1.4-i386-1.4.0.99beta
> package sources (more specifically this file) which the lastest debian
> package released by the Blackdown project -, and uses the same binaries in
> j2sdk-1.4.1-01-linux-i586-gcc3.2.bin . The patch showing the (minimal)
> changes I've made is here. "
>
> Jag hittade en kille som gjort deb paket av 1.4.1 på
> deb http://jrfonseca.dyndns.org/debian ./
> deb-src http://jrfonseca.dyndns.org/debian ./

Det där ser väldigt rätt ut. :) Jag har inte kvar frågeställarens 
e-postmeddelande, men det där är i a f vad han letar efter.

*/ Christoffer Sawicki <[EMAIL PROTECTED]>